Transaction 16df77a8b91b367688c88eace25c10cdfcb1a14ea2ca8422c3ba3f3ff9a5642c

1 Input
2 Outputs
  • 16df77a8b91b367688c88eace25c10cdfcb1a14ea2ca8422c3ba3f3ff9a5642c:0
  • value  7674500
    address  18ZH9rJiaf8M1seKs7UNMPWbRNCyTtVtJh
  • 16df77a8b91b367688c88eace25c10cdfcb1a14ea2ca8422c3ba3f3ff9a5642c:1
  • value  17769417
    address  3EUcdvPFkgs2HYbEaqN5Mcato8cxQvBdV3